How much do remote insurance claims j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ote insurance claims in Greer, SC is $22.60,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.88 and $24.71 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in remote insurance claims?

To thrive in a Remote Insurance Claims role, you need a solid understanding of insurance policies, claims processing, and investigative techniques, often supported by experience in insurance or a related field. Familiarity with claims management software, customer relationship management (CRM) systems, and sometimes required certifications such as AIC (Associate in Claims) are important. Exceptional communication, active listening, time management, and problem-solving skills help professionals excel in remote, client-facing environments. These abilities ensure accuracy, efficiency, and positive customer experiences throughout the claims resolution process.

What is a remote insurance claims?

A Remote Insurance Claims job involves reviewing, processing, and managing insurance claims from a remote location. Professionals in this role assess documentation, communicate with policyholders, and determine claim validity based on policy terms. They may work for insurance companies, third-party administrators, or as independent adjusters. Strong analytical, communication, and customer service skills are essential for success in this position.

What are some common challenges faced in a remote insurance claims role and how are they managed?

One common challenge in a Remote Insurance Claims role is maintaining effective communication with clients and team members while working outside a traditional office environment. Professionals overcome this by utilizing secure messaging, video conferencing, and robust claims management platforms to ensure consistent updates and collaboration. Staying organized and self-motivated is also key, as remote claims adjusters often manage a high volume of cases independently. Employers typically provide training and ongoing support to help remote employees navigate complex claims, maintain compliance, and deliver timely resolutions.

Job Summary
A direct hire opportunity is available for a Mortgage Claims Quality Analyst with strong mortgage servicing and government foreclosure claims experience. This fully remote role is ideal for a detail-oriented professional who enjoys reviewing mortgage insurance claims, validating documentation, and ensuring compliance with agency and investor requirements.
This position offers the stability of a full-time schedule, company-provided equipment, and the opportunity to work with a specialized claims team focused on accuracy, quality, and continuous improvement. Candidates can expect a collaborative remote work environment with supportive leadership, clear expectations, and a team-oriented approach to problem solving.
Key Responsibilities
- Review mortgage insurance claims for accuracy, completeness, and compliance prior to submission.
- Verify claim calculations, supporting documentation, loan data, and servicing information.
- Identify discrepancies, missing documents, calculation errors, or compliance concerns and coordinate with internal teams to resolve issues.
- Ensure claims align with FHA, VA, USDA, investor, and agency guidelines.
- Maintain accurate quality review records, production tracking, and documentation notes.
- Research claim-related issues and contribute to process improvements that support quality and compliance.

About AppleOne

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

AppleOne is a renowned staffing service based in Glendale, California, USA. Positioned in the Human Resources industry, the company offers extensive staffing and recruiting solutions, such as temporary, full-time, and part-time placement, to companies across diverse industry sectors. The company was established by Bernie Howroyd in 1964, launching the business to aid others in finding excellent jobs and companies in finding excellent people.
